1. Walking - The Foundation of Human Movement

Walking stands as perhaps the most underestimated yet powerful exercise in the human movement repertoire, offering profound health benefits that extend far beyond simple cardiovascular improvement. Research published in the American Journal of Preventive Medicine reveals that individuals who walk regularly experience a 30-35% reduction in all-cause mortality compared to sedentary counterparts. The beauty of walking lies in its accessibility and scalability – it requires no equipment, can be performed virtually anywhere, and can be easily modified to accommodate varying fitness levels and physical limitations. Studies demonstrate that even modest walking programs, such as 150 minutes per week at a moderate pace, significantly reduce the risk of heart disease, stroke, diabetes, and certain cancers. Furthermore, walking stimulates the production of brain-derived neurotrophic factor (BDNF), which promotes neuroplasticity and cognitive function, making it a powerful tool for maintaining mental acuity as we age. The weight-bearing nature of walking also helps maintain bone density, while the rhythmic, bilateral movement pattern enhances coordination and balance, reducing fall risk in older adults.
2. Swimming - The Perfect Full-Body Workout

Swimming emerges as the quintessential low-impact exercise, providing comprehensive fitness benefits while eliminating joint stress through the buoyant properties of water. The hydrostatic pressure of water creates a natural compression garment effect, improving circulation and reducing inflammation while simultaneously providing resistance that strengthens muscles throughout the entire body. Research from the International Journal of Aquatic Research and Education demonstrates that regular swimming can improve cardiovascular fitness by up to 25% while simultaneously enhancing muscular strength, endurance, and flexibility. The unique environment of water allows individuals with arthritis, joint replacements, or chronic pain conditions to exercise comfortably, often achieving fitness gains that would be impossible on land. Swimming engages both large and small muscle groups in coordinated movement patterns, promoting functional strength and neuromuscular coordination. Additionally, the rhythmic breathing required in swimming serves as a form of moving meditation, reducing stress hormones and promoting mental well-being. The thermal properties of water also provide therapeutic benefits, with cooler water temperatures stimulating metabolism and circulation while warmer water helps relax muscles and reduce stiffness.
3. Yoga - Ancient Wisdom Meets Modern Science

Yoga represents a sophisticated system of movement, breathing, and mindfulness that has been refined over thousands of years, now validated by extensive scientific research for its remarkable health benefits. Studies published in the Journal of Clinical Medicine demonstrate that regular yoga practice can reduce chronic pain by up to 40%, improve flexibility by 35%, and significantly enhance balance and proprioception. The practice uniquely combines physical postures (asanas), controlled breathing (pranayama), and meditation, creating a holistic approach to health that addresses both physical and mental well-being simultaneously. Research indicates that yoga practitioners experience lower levels of inflammatory markers, improved immune function, and better stress resilience compared to non-practitioners. The isometric nature of many yoga poses builds functional strength while promoting joint mobility and stability, making it particularly beneficial for aging adults. Furthermore, the mindfulness component of yoga has been shown to improve sleep quality, reduce anxiety and depression, and enhance overall quality of life. The beauty of yoga lies in its adaptability – poses can be modified or supported with props to accommodate any physical limitation, making it accessible to virtually everyone regardless of age or fitness level.
4. Cycling - Efficient Cardiovascular Training with Joint Protection

Cycling stands out as an exceptionally efficient cardiovascular exercise that delivers maximum health benefits while minimizing impact stress on the joints, particularly the knees, hips, and ankles. Research from the British Journal of Sports Medicine reveals that regular cycling can reduce the risk of cardiovascular disease by up to 46% and all-cause mortality by 41%. The seated position and smooth, circular motion of pedaling distribute forces evenly across large muscle groups while avoiding the repetitive impact associated with running or jumping activities. Studies demonstrate that cycling improves not only cardiovascular fitness but also muscular strength, particularly in the lower body, while enhancing coordination and balance through the complex motor patterns required for bike handling. The versatility of cycling allows for easy progression and variation – from leisurely rides for beginners to high-intensity interval training for advanced practitioners. Indoor cycling options provide year-round accessibility and controlled environments, while outdoor cycling offers additional benefits including vitamin D synthesis from sun exposure and the mental health benefits of nature interaction. Research also indicates that cycling can improve cognitive function and reduce the risk of neurodegenerative diseases, possibly due to the complex motor skills and spatial awareness required for safe navigation.
5. Tai Chi - Moving Meditation for Balance and Strength

Tai Chi, often described as "meditation in motion," represents a sophisticated form of exercise that combines slow, flowing movements with deep breathing and mental focus, delivering profound health benefits that extend far beyond traditional fitness parameters. Research published in the New England Journal of Medicine demonstrates that Tai Chi practice can reduce fall risk in older adults by up to 45% while significantly improving balance, strength, and cognitive function. The gentle, continuous movements of Tai Chi promote joint mobility and muscular strength through functional range-of-motion exercises that mirror daily activities. Studies show that regular Tai Chi practice can lower blood pressure, reduce chronic pain, improve sleep quality, and enhance immune function. The weight-shifting movements inherent in Tai Chi forms strengthen the core and lower body muscles essential for stability and mobility, while the coordinated arm movements improve upper body strength and flexibility. The mindfulness component of Tai Chi has been shown to reduce stress hormones, improve mood, and enhance cognitive performance, making it particularly valuable for managing age-related cognitive decline. The social aspect of group Tai Chi classes also provides important community connections that contribute to overall well-being and longevity.
6. Resistance Band Training - Portable Strength Building

Resistance band training offers a remarkably effective and accessible approach to strength building that provides variable resistance throughout the full range of motion, creating unique training stimuli that complement traditional weight training. Research from the Journal of Sports Medicine and Physical Fitness demonstrates that resistance band exercises can produce strength gains comparable to free weights while offering superior portability and safety. The elastic properties of resistance bands create accommodating resistance, meaning the tension increases as the band stretches, which better matches the strength curve of human muscles and reduces stress on joints at vulnerable positions. Studies show that resistance band training effectively improves muscular strength, endurance, and power while enhancing functional movement patterns essential for daily activities. The versatility of resistance bands allows for exercises targeting every major muscle group, with the ability to easily modify resistance levels by adjusting grip position, band length, or using multiple bands simultaneously. Research indicates that resistance band training can improve bone density, reduce joint pain, and enhance balance and coordination. The portable nature of resistance bands eliminates barriers to exercise, allowing for consistent training regardless of location or schedule constraints, which is crucial for long-term adherence and health benefits.
7. Pilates - Core Strength and Postural Alignment

Pilates represents a sophisticated movement system that emphasizes core strength, postural alignment, and controlled movement quality, delivering comprehensive fitness benefits through precisely executed exercises that integrate mind and body awareness. Research published in the Journal of Bodywork and Movement Therapies demonstrates that regular Pilates practice can improve core strength by up to 50%, reduce chronic low back pain by 40%, and significantly enhance postural alignment and movement efficiency. The fundamental principles of Pilates – concentration, control, centering, flow, precision, and breathing – create a unique training environment that develops both physical and mental discipline. Studies show that Pilates exercises effectively strengthen deep stabilizing muscles, particularly the transverse abdominis, multifidus, and pelvic floor muscles, which are essential for spinal stability and injury prevention. The emphasis on controlled movement and proper alignment in Pilates helps correct muscular imbalances and movement dysfunction that often develop from prolonged sitting and poor postural habits. Research indicates that Pilates practice can improve flexibility, balance, and coordination while reducing stress and enhancing overall quality of life. The adaptability of Pilates exercises allows for modifications to accommodate various fitness levels and physical limitations, making it suitable for rehabilitation settings as well as general fitness applications.
8. Elliptical Training - Low-Impact Cardiovascular Excellence

Elliptical training provides an exceptional cardiovascular workout that mimics the natural movement patterns of walking and running while eliminating the impact forces that can stress joints and connective tissues. Research from the American Council on Exercise demonstrates that elliptical training can provide cardiovascular benefits equivalent to running while reducing joint stress by up to 75%. The elliptical motion engages both upper and lower body muscle groups simultaneously, creating a comprehensive workout that burns calories efficiently while building functional strength. Studies show that regular elliptical training improves cardiovascular fitness, muscular endurance, and coordination while being particularly beneficial for individuals with joint problems, arthritis, or previous injuries. The ability to adjust resistance and incline on most elliptical machines allows for progressive overload and workout variety, preventing adaptation and maintaining training effectiveness over time. Research indicates that elliptical training can improve bone density in the lower body while being gentle enough for daily use without excessive fatigue or recovery requirements. The reverse motion capability of many elliptical machines provides additional training variety and helps balance muscle development by working muscles from different angles and movement patterns.
9. Water Aerobics - Therapeutic Exercise in a Supportive Environment

Water aerobics combines the cardiovascular benefits of traditional aerobic exercise with the therapeutic properties of water, creating an ideal exercise environment for individuals seeking effective, low-impact fitness solutions. Research published in the International Journal of Aquatic Research and Education demonstrates that water aerobics can improve cardiovascular fitness by up to 20% while simultaneously reducing joint pain and stiffness in individuals with arthritis and other musculoskeletal conditions. The buoyancy of water reduces body weight by up to 90%, allowing individuals to perform movements and exercises that might be difficult or impossible on land. Studies show that the hydrostatic pressure of water provides natural compression that improves circulation, reduces swelling, and enhances proprioception and balance. The resistance properties of water provide strength training benefits in all directions of movement, creating a three-dimensional workout that engages stabilizing muscles throughout the body. Research indicates that water aerobics can improve flexibility, muscular strength, and endurance while providing significant mental health benefits through the relaxing properties of water and the social interaction of group classes. The temperature-controlled environment of most pools allows for year-round exercise consistency, which is crucial for maintaining long-term health benefits.
10. Stationary Rowing - Full-Body Cardiovascular and Strength Training

Stationary rowing delivers one of the most comprehensive full-body workouts available, engaging approximately 85% of the body's muscles while providing excellent cardiovascular conditioning in a low-impact environment. Research from the Journal of Sports Sciences demonstrates that rowing can burn up to 600 calories per hour while building strength in the legs, core, back, and arms through a single, coordinated movement pattern. The seated position and smooth, gliding motion of rowing eliminate impact stress while the resistance can be easily adjusted to accommodate different fitness levels and training goals. Studies show that regular rowing exercise improves cardiovascular fitness, muscular strength and endurance, and postural alignment while being particularly effective for developing core stability and back strength. The rhythmic nature of rowing promotes proper breathing patterns and can serve as a form of moving meditation, reducing stress and improving mental well-being. Research indicates that rowing exercise can improve bone density, particularly in the spine and hips, while the coordinated movement patterns enhance neuromuscular coordination and balance. The efficiency of rowing as a time-effective workout makes it ideal for busy individuals seeking maximum health benefits from minimal time investment.
11. Gentle Stretching and Mobility Work - The Foundation of Movement Health

Gentle stretching and mobility work form the often-overlooked foundation of long-term movement health, providing essential maintenance for joints, muscles, and connective tissues that enables all other forms of exercise to be performed safely and effectively. Research published in the Journal of Aging and Physical Activity demonstrates that regular stretching can improve flexibility by up to 30%, reduce muscle tension and pain, and significantly enhance quality of life in older adults. The systematic approach to stretching major muscle groups helps maintain and restore normal range of motion, preventing the gradual loss of mobility that often accompanies aging and sedentary lifestyles. Studies show that stretching exercises improve circulation, reduce muscle stiffness, and enhance neuromuscular coordination while providing stress-reduction benefits through focused breathing and mindful movement. The accessibility of stretching makes it an ideal exercise for individuals with limited mobility or those beginning an exercise program, as it requires no equipment and can be performed virtually anywhere. Research indicates that combining static and dynamic stretching approaches provides optimal benefits, with static stretching improving flexibility and dynamic stretching enhancing functional movement patterns. The cumulative effects of regular stretching practice include improved posture, reduced injury risk, and enhanced performance in all other physical activities.
12. Balance Training - Preventing Falls and Enhancing Stability

Balance training represents a critical yet often neglected component of comprehensive fitness that becomes increasingly important with age, as it directly impacts fall risk, functional independence, and overall quality of life. Research from the Journal of the American Geriatrics Society demonstrates that structured balance training can reduce fall risk by up to 40% in older adults while improving confidence and mobility in daily activities. Balance exercises challenge the complex integration of sensory systems including vision, vestibular function, and proprioception, creating adaptations that enhance stability and reaction time. Studies show that balance training improves not only static balance but also dynamic balance, which is essential for navigating real-world environments safely and confidently. The progression from simple single-leg stands to more complex multi-planar movements allows for continuous challenge and improvement throughout the lifespan. Research indicates that balance training can improve cognitive function, possibly due to the complex motor planning and attention required for challenging balance tasks. The integration of balance challenges into other exercises, such as standing on one leg while performing arm movements, maximizes training efficiency while developing functional stability that transfers to daily activities and sports performance.
